Summary
The bill changes the law so court officers can enforce rules on court parking lots and other areas next to a courthouse. It also gives them police powers when they are at hearings held outside a courthouse, when escorting jurors or judges, or when handling detainees. The goal is to improve safety for remote court proceedings and related activities.
